Repro bed

Between my 70 Chevrolet and a 69 parts truck I have two beds. A swb and a step side. Neither in great shape. Does anyone have experience in putting a swb together using reproduction sheet metal? It's a large chunk of cash to drop on a bed if they have ill fitting panels or quality issues. Thoughts? Anyone have pictures?

to the forums and from Ohio. My suggestion is to find a nice used bed and install it.

You might check out the FS forums and something might pop up. The reason I say this is because to put together parts from various beds to make one good bed can be expensive and challenging. The best of luck..
